Dr. Kathleen Seurynck is a Full Professor at Eastern Michigan University’s School of Nursing and a Certified Nurse Educator and Certified Healthcare Simulation Educator. With over three decades of experience in nursing education and clinical practice, she is recognized for her leadership in interprofessional education, simulation-based learning, and curriculum development. Dr. Seurynck’s scholarship includes multiple peer-reviewed publications, national presentations, and grant-funded research focused on immersive simulation and team-based care. She holds a DNP from Oakland University and an MS in Medical-Surgical Nursing from the University of Michigan. Her work continues to advance collaborative, evidence-based nursing education.
